Desiccant Dehumidification v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ional in Mercer Island, WA
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small, isolated moisture issue | Yes | No | DIY solutions can be effective for small, contained moisture issues. |
| Large, widespread moisture damage | No | Yes | Professional equipment and expertise are necessary to address extensive moisture damage. |
| Hidden moisture or musty odors | No | Yes | Hidden moisture can lead to costly repairs if left unchecked; professional help is necessary to identify and address the issue. |
| Insured property with moisture damage | No | Yes | Insurance companies often need professional documentation and assessment for moisture damage claims. |
| Moisture damage affecting structural integrity | No | Yes | Moisture damage to structural elements can compromise the safety and integrity of your home. |
| Concerns about mold growth or health risks | No | Yes | Mold growth or health risks need professional attention to ensure the safety and health of occupants. |
With desiccant dehumidification, it’s essential to consider your specific situation. While DIY solutions can be effective for small, contained moisture issues, professional help is often necessary for more extensive or hidden moisture damage. Desiccant Dehumidification Cost in Mercer Island, WA
The cost of desiccant dehumidification services can vary depending on the severity of the moisture iss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Mercer Island, WA. Our team will provide you with a detailed estimate based on your unique situation. Don’t let cost concerns hold you back from addressing moisture damage.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and planning | $200 – $500 | Severity of moisture issue, size of affected area, local conditions |
| Equipment rental and setup | $500 – $2,500 | Number and type of equipment needed, duration of rental |
| Continuous monitoring and adjustments | $500 – $1,000 | Complexity of moisture issue, number of adjustments required |
| Final drying and verification | $200 – $500 | Size of affected area, complexity of drying process |
| Insurance-friendly documentation | $100 – $300 | Complexity of claim, number of documentation requirements |
| More services (e.g., mold remediation) | $500 – $2,000 | Nature and extent of more services required |
